The National Monuments Service's description
In rough pasture, on N-facing slope of limestone ridge. Circular area (24m N-S; 24m E-W) enclosed by denuded earth-and-stone bank (int. H 0.35m; ext. H 1.05m) best preserved NW->NE. Field boundary, which formerly skirted enclosure at N, is recently removed; uneven surface of interior may result from dumping of this material here. Interior is covered by thistles.
